How Reliable is the Ford Mondeo?

Based on 12,239,875 MOT tests across 1,205,291 vehicles.

70.1%
Pass Rate
7,416
Miles/Year
33
Year Lifespan
1,205,291
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 610,562
Brake pipe excessively corroded 513,490
Parking brake: efficiency below requirements 357,218
position lamp(s) not working 250,827
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 244,051

Does FD12 YMR have outstanding finance?

Finance checks require a premium vehicle report. This checks against all major UK finance providers to see if there is any outstanding finance on FD12 YMR. If you buy a car with outstanding finance, the finance company can repossess it.
